Presentation
Jean-Philippe Rigotti was born in 1970 in Savoie. He devoted himself to a discipline invented by his grandfather in the mid-1970s: engraving on 23.6 carat gold leaf.
With the obsession to achieve a realism that sublimates the original beauty, he reappropriates the photographs. He deconstructs to better recompose in a three-dimensionality that will arouse even more emotion. It exalts the senses thanks to the striking contrast between the brilliance of gold and the depth of blacks.
Although his monochrome works are reminiscent of daguerreotypes, his work has been strongly influenced by the emotion of Caravaggio's chiaroscuro and the genius of Pierre Soulages who confront us with the power of blacks.
It is an exclusive technique of the Artist, who today is still the only one in the world to offer real three-dimensional work on gold leaf, scintillating and delicate works, but intense and of great depth.
